Unveiling the Critical Role of Feed Premix Solutions in Enhancing Animal Nutrition and Driving Agricultural Sustainability Across Diverse Farming Practices Globally
The feed premix sector has emerged as a linchpin in modern animal nutrition, reflecting an evolving agricultural ecosystem that demands precision, quality, and sustainability. As global populations surge and consumer preferences shift toward nutrient-rich animal proteins, the requirement for fortified feed ingredients has intensified. Integrating vitamins, minerals, enzymes, amino acids, and probiotics into concentrated blends, feed premix solutions address critical gaps in conventional feed formulations, ensuring consistent nutrient delivery and supporting optimal growth, immunity, and productivity.Amid stringent regulatory regimes and heightened scrutiny over food safety, producers are compelled to adopt innovative premix technologies that guarantee traceability and compliance. Simultaneously, rising input costs and supply chain disruptions underscore the necessity for resilient sourcing strategies. Consequently, stakeholders across commercial feed mills, smallholder farmers, and specialty aquaculture and pet care segments are reevaluating procurement models, forging closer partnerships with ingredient specialists to co-develop precision-tailored premixes that align with species-specific dietary requirements.
Through this lens, feed premix transcends its traditional role as a mere additive, evolving into a strategic enabler of animal health management and farm-level profitability. Analyzing Intricate Segmentation Dimensions to Illuminate Demand Drivers Across Feed Premix Product and Market Channels
A multifaceted segmentation analysis reveals the nuanced drivers behind feed premix demand. Examining the product dimension, amino acids and enzymes have become indispensable for optimizing metabolic efficiency, while minerals, spanning both macro and micro categories, play vital roles in bone development, immunity, and enzymatic functions. Vitamins, including B complex, A, D, E, and K, are fundamental to numerous physiological processes, and probiotic formulations continue gaining traction as natural growth and health enhancers.Considering the end consumer, feed premix adoption varies significantly across aquaculture ventures, commercial poultry operations, ruminant enterprises, swine production systems, and the burgeoning pet care segment. Each animal category exhibits distinct nutritional profiles and sensitivity to premix composition. Moreover, delivery format influences performance outcomes: liquid blends enable rapid dispersion in high-moisture feeds, whereas powder concentrates offer ease of handling and extended shelf stability, suiting diverse manufacturing preferences.
Application-specific insights further differentiate demand, as dry feed, liquid feed, and pelleted feed processors each require tailor-made premix formulations to optimize stability, palatability, and nutrient release characteristics. Distribution dynamics also play a critical role; manufacturers leverage direct sales for customized solutions, engage distributors to extend market reach, and harness online channels to address the needs of smaller-scale producers. Ultimately, the balance between commercial feed mills and independent farmers shapes procurement patterns, underscoring the criticality of flexible supply mechanisms and targeted marketing strategies.
Examining Regional Dynamics to Reveal Strategic Opportunities and Challenges in Feed Premix Adoption Across Major Geographies
Regional nuances are central to understanding feed premix trajectories. In the Americas, robust livestock production systems and stringent quality standards have fostered sophisticated premix markets that emphasize traceability and performance validation. Producers in North and South America alike prioritize high-purity ingredients, and ongoing consolidation among regional ingredient suppliers underscores the importance of integrated value chains.Within Europe, Middle East & Africa, regulatory harmonization across the European Union has propelled stringent safety benchmarks, driving innovation in natural and organic premix alternatives. Meanwhile, emerging economies in the Middle East and Africa are experiencing surges in feed demand, particularly within poultry and aquaculture sectors, spurring opportunities for capacity expansion and localized ingredient development.
The Asia-Pacific region exhibits some of the fastest growth rates, fueled by expanding mammalian and avian protein consumption in countries such as China and India. Rapid urbanization, shifting dietary patterns, and government initiatives supporting agricultural modernization are boosting investments in precision feeding technologies. Collectively, these regional insights reveal distinct opportunity spaces and highlight the need for market entry and expansion strategies tailored to specific regulatory, cultural, and economic contexts.
